What's the difference between the Supernote cloud connection and the Browse & Access connection?

Two completely separate connections. (1) The cloud connection (over the internet, via your Supernote account) syncs your to-dos both ways. (2) Browse & Access is a direct link to your tablet over your home Wi-Fi (the device runs a small file server while it's switched on). The app uses Browse & Access to pull the actual handwritten note pages a to-do links to, converting them to a viewable PDF — this is optional and up to you. Your to-dos sync fine even if Browse & Access is off; for the notes themselves, the app can also offer to download the last copy your device synced to the Supernote cloud — handy when the tablet's off or away, though it may be behind your latest ink.
